Why Feniscowles Appeals to Families
Feniscowles offers a welcoming community atmosphere while still being conveniently located near Blackburn. Residents have access to everyday amenities and open areas, which supports family life.
Those travelling for work will find road connections across Lancashire convenient. This allows homeowners to enjoy quieter surroundings without being far from essential amenities.
Outdoor living is another advantage. Feniscowles is close to walking routes and green countryside. Detached homes here often include private gardens, creating an area for family activities and relaxation.
